The Women’s Rehab Process Has to Be Totally Different from That of Men

The Women’s rehab programs help to eliminate the physical addiction to substances and on the mental front helps to forget the past sufferings. Slowly these female addicts are re-invigorated to return into a proper and healthy social life. Recent researches have shown that substance addiction in women usually starts after a traumatic sexual or physical abusive event. It has been found in most of the women's rehabilitation programs, that almost 75% of the admitted cases are victims of some form of sexual and physical abuse.

The Reason for Setting up an All Women’s Rehab

The overall number of females getting addicted to drugs and alcohol is much less as compared to males. However, it is also a fact that females are more susceptible to illness than males. They are more easy victims of eating disorders, body structure, weakness and fatigue, weight loss or gain. Hence at a physical level, they need to be taken care of more sensitively. Then again then are female-specific issues which they will be able to share only with female doctors or therapists in a women’s rehab. The in-depth opening of each and every trauma especially physical is the need of the hour.

It is only after opening up completely, that the desired counselling and psychotherapeutic treatment can be implemented. This is the most important reason for setting up exclusive women’s rehab centers, along with the fact that women develop a sense of bonding with the other ladies who are experiencing similar problems. It helps them to share their experiences with one another and also guide one another.
In many cases, lifelong friendships are created. Empathy is an important factor which awakens a human soul from its own depravations and makes the path to recovery easier.

Women’s Inpatient Rehab. Is it needed?

Before we answer this, let us understand what women’s Inpatient rehab means. In simplest terms for understanding, any rehab program in which you have to be admitted into a rehab center is an inpatient rehab program. Do you need it? Yes, if you have withdrawal symptoms which need medical attention. The one which if left alone can cause lethality. Hence depending upon your condition you might need to go for an inpatient rehab program. This is a widely noted phenomenon in case of alcohol rehab for women. Then again depends upon which state of alcohol withdrawal you are will be the deciding factor for this. If the symptoms are serious and there are life-threatening signs then inpatient alcohol rehab for women is a must.
